Transaction 62b07116b5151f9618ddb4fb2cf6fcf5ec4a137b242d26034da07dc781209f53
1 Input
1 Output
-
62b07116b5151f9618ddb4fb2cf6fcf5ec4a137b242d26034da07dc781209f53: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e45b9a81ed8c0e3192fabb198d8c89858828fedbadb363ee6f2f40bb480ca3f7
- address
- bc1pu3de4q0d3s8rryh6hvvcmryfskyz3lkm4kek8mn09aqtkjqv50msvuj2mz